Ecuador declares emergency rule in main port to fight crime

QUITO: Ecuador on Saturday declared a state of emergency within the nation’s main port and different areas reeling from drug-related crime.

The decree permits safety forces to arrange checkpoints and conduct warrantless searches of individuals and property.

Talking in a televised tackle to the nation, President Guillermo Lasso mentioned he had declared a state of emergency within the port of Guayaquil and the neighboring districts of Duran and Samborondon, in addition to in Santa Elena and Los Rios provinces.

Lasso added that the state of emergency included a nightly curfew from 1 am to five am within the affected areas.

Final yr, Lasso declared comparable short-term states of emergency 3 times for Guayaquil, which has confronted a pointy spike in organized-crime-related killings.

Lasso didn’t say how lengthy the present state of emergency would final.

“We now have a typical enemy: delinquency, drug trafficking and arranged crime,” mentioned Lasso, a right-wing former banker who took workplace practically two years in the past.

Ecuador, which is sandwiched between main cocaine producers Colombia and Peru, has been hit by a wave of violent crime that authorities blame on turf battles between drug gangs.

The nation has develop into a significant drug distribution middle for narcotics certain for america and Europe.
